app store.

This commit is contained in:
Bryce Covert
2016-05-25 10:21:09 -07:00
parent c8e9926816
commit 96938aafd3
17 changed files with 1481 additions and 2 deletions

9
desktop/release-app-store.sh Normal file → Executable file
View File

@@ -1 +1,8 @@
productbuild --sign "3rd Party Mac Developer Installer: Bryce Covert" --component target/osx/Tick\'s\ Tales.app /Applications target/osx/ticks-tales.pkg
#!/bin/bash
rm -rf test-osx/Tick\'s\ Tales.app
cp -R target/osx/Tick\'s\ Tales.app test-osx
cat test-osx/Info.plist | sed "s/633/`cat last-release`/" > test-osx/Tick\'s\ Tales.app/Contents/Info.plist
rm -rf test-osx/Tick\'s\ Tales.app/
codesign --verbose -v -f --entitlements test-osx/Tick\'s\ Tales.entitlements --sign "3rd Party Mac Developer Application: Phoenix Online Studios LLC (AVDPGBD777)" test-osx/Tick\'s\ Tales.app/Contents/MacOS/advent-standalone.jar
codesign --verbose --deep -v -f --entitlements test-osx/Tick\'s\ Tales.entitlements --sign "3rd Party Mac Developer Application: Phoenix Online Studios LLC (AVDPGBD777)" test-osx/Tick\'s\ Tales.app/Contents/MacOS/jre
# productbuild --sign "3rd Party Mac Developer Installer: Bryce Covert" --component target/osx/Tick\'s\ Tales.app /Applications target/osx/ticks-tales.pkg